The death has occurred of

Eleanor Dolores McGibbon (née Moore)

McGibbon (née Moore) (9 Killough Gardens, Lurgan), August 17, 2025 peacefully at home surrounded by her loving family.

Eleanor (Dolores), adored wife of William, loving mother of Sharon, Anthony, Denise, Liam and the late Kieran, and a dear mother-in-law to Annemarie, Sharon and Nigel. A devoted granny to Maria, Christopher, Gemma, Peadar, Trystan, Barry, Niamh, Anthony and Ellen and great grandchildren Lorcán, Aoibh, Comheá, Cíanna-Rogha, Reggie and Caoimhín. Beloved daughter of the late Joseph and Ellen Moore (Shankill) and loving sister of Patricia and the late Veronica, Frank, Joan, Marie and Jim.

Funeral today, Wednesday at 9.15am to St Paul’s Church, Lurgan for 10.00am Requiem Mass. Burial afterwards in St. Colman’s Cemetery.

Dolores’ Requiem Mass can also be viewed on St. Paul’s Parish webcam via https://www.lurganparish.com/stpauls-webcam/
No flowers please with donations in lieu if desired to Dementia NI via mcalindenandmurtagh.com or the donation box at the home.

Saint Padre Pio pray for her.

Always loved and remembered by her entire family circle.

Special thanks to Ann’s Homecare for their dedicated care and support.
